What to check first
- Confirm lawful authorization and identify the exact property, door, lock or vehicle.
- Take clear photos and record brand, model, year or visible part numbers.
- Separate urgent access needs from long-term security improvements.
- Ask for the scope, likely parts, price factors and post-service testing.
Common mistakes to avoid
Avoid forcing a key, repeatedly cycling a failing smart lock, buying incompatible hardware, or authorizing destructive work before alternatives are explained.
After-service checklist
Test every key, latch, handle, lock position, remote, emergency egress feature and door alignment. Save invoices, model numbers, codes and key-control records.
